Queensland
Lecture honors poet Gūtmanis

Arvids Biela will present a lecture honoring the poet Olafs Gūtmanis at 14:00 hours April 19 at Saule Ltd. (Latvian House), 24 Church Court, Buranda. This event, which will include readings of Gūtmanis’ poetry, is hosted by the Literary Society of the Brisbane Latvian Association. Admission by donation.

New Jersey
Raisters Fund laureate announced

Vilnis Baumanis will be honored at the annual Ēriks Raisters Memorial Fund function at 2 p.m. April 19 at Priedaine, 1017 Highway 33 East, Freehold. Baumanis, known for his central role in the musical ensemble Trīs no Pārdaugavas, will read his own humorous poetry at the event. Rita Gāle will speak about the laureate and a film about the ensemble’s visit to Latvia will be shown. Admission is USD 15. For more information visit Priedaine’s Web site at www.priedaine.org.

United Kingdom
Dūdalnieki celebrate 25th anniversary

The Latvian folk music group Dūdalnieki will celebrate its 25th aniversary at 17:30 hours April 19 at the Daugavas Vanagi Fund House - Bradford, 5 Clifton Villas, Bradford, West Yorkshire. The evening will begin with a concert by Dūdalnieki, the Leeds Latvian dance group Kamoliņš and guest folk group Grodi from Latvia. District of Columbia
Estonian president to speak at U.S.-Baltic Foundation gala

President of Estonia Toomas Hendrik Ilves, guest of honor and keynote speaker at the 2008 U.S.-Baltic Foundation Celebration, will speak at 6 p.m. April 19 in the Renaissance Mayflower Hotel, 1127 Connecticut Ave NW, Washington, D.C. The celebration will headline a three-day series of Baltic cultural and business development events on April 18- 20. Sponsored by the U.S.-Baltic Foundation (USBF), the gala will feature a business conference, an exchange program summit, a silent auction and black-tie gala dinner to highlight relations between the U.S. and the Baltic States.
